Unlike other new moons, Scorpio new moon is intense. It is a time for deep, psychological work within, getting to the bottom of our vulnerability and power. And this new moon is also an eclipse. So they are highly charged New Moons, aka the cosmic crossroads and tornados. They bring up special events that take us in a whole new direction. it's destablizing.

This New Moon Solar eclipse occurs at 2˚ Scorpio on October 25, 2022, at 6:49 pm HKT.

Venus is a big player for this solar eclipse and brings up the relationship topics. Venus is the planet of love, attraction, and how we show up for ourselves, people, and our likes and dislikes. Venus in Scorpio isn't about the cute, vanilla, surface-level love, but the depth of our emotional truth.The kind of love that transcends and transforms, where we go to get in touch with our raw and authentic selves through our relationships, sexuality, and intimacy. It is not for the faint of heart.

On top of that, Pluto in Capricorn forms an out-of-sign square to them (Sun, Moon, Venus) and Mercury in Libra. That's a complicated affair. It can trigger power struggles, obsessive feelings, thinking, and survival of identity. You want to assert control or break ties with them. It activated the fight or flight in us because with a square with Pluto, we feel like we have to act. Because our compulsion tells us EVERYTHING about this situation hurts.

Like the weather, some things we just don't have control over. And don't even try it with Pluto. The key here is to identify what you have no control over (other people's opinions and actions and probably a bunch of other things.) and what you can control (your action, reaction, agency, and the role you play in the wicked world). By changing your responses, you are letting yourself off the hook.

New Moons are seeds; they bring new awareness and opportunities to us. For an eclipse to play out, it usually takes six months. It may be destabilizing time but whatever comes up is an opening opportunity to heal and transform ourselves. However, this is a great time to reconsider our action and how it has served our values. We started the year with a Venus Retrograde, ending the year with Mars retrograde (Mars Rx on October 30 and turns direct on January 12, 2023). It is a reminder for us that we not only need to claim our values and also act according to them. What do we value? What are we willing to let go?
